Dental X-Rays

A dental X-rays is made possible by a machine that very briefly radiates a small plate positioned behind teeth.

Since radiation can penetrate hard objects, the plate picks up images of the internal structures of the jaw and mouth with a high level of accuracy. Digital X-rays are preferred to film, since they are computerized, instantly available and require less radiation levels.

The reason we periodically take a set of x-rays is to detect the presence of a number of abnormalities, including…

  • Cavities and cracks
  • Bone or gum loss
  • Periodontal disease
  • Possible benign or malignant tumors

Dental Fillings

Checking for dental cavities is one of the most important reasons for visiting a dentist. The sooner a cavity is discovered, the smaller the repair will be.

Once a cavity is diagnosed, a dental filling is installed in the area of the affected. Fillings preserve the integrity of the tooth and prevents further damage. Tooth-colored fillings can be used to match the natural tint of your enamel, making them virtually undetectable!

Fillings can also be used to maintain the chewing surfaces of teeth that have become worn. Proper dental hygiene prevents cavities, but once they appear, fillings can be the answer!

Dental Crowns

Worn or damaged teeth can be markedly improved with dental crowns, a.k.a. caps. Crowns can also solve some cosmetic issues, bringing back the natural color your smile.  Just how do they work?

A mold is taken of the existing tooth and shaped by the dentist to fit precisely with you bite. Molds are then sent off to a lab for fabrication. You may be fitted with a temporary crown to protect a damaged tooth while the permanent crown is made. Depending on the material used, as well as the wear and care they receive, permanent crowns should last five to fifteen years!

Dental Bridges

These time-tested appliances can “bridge the gap” created by one or more missing teeth. A bridge is made up of two or more artificial teeth. They are supported either by natural teeth or dental implants positioned on either side of the gap.
